Abby Stayart
Send a message

Places (1)

Abby Stayart
Aquarium

Old Town Aquarium Chicago

Open now

4018 W Irving Park Rd, Chicago, IL 60641, USA

(no reviews)
$$

Reviews (0)

No recent reviews